Explanation:
Detailed explanation-1: -The urinary bladder can store up to 500 ml of urine in women and 700 ml in men.
Detailed explanation-2: -found that although the growth of the bladder neck increased proportional to the gestational age, males (20–40-week gestation) have a denser internal sphincter and a significantly narrower bladder neck in comparison to females [34].
Detailed explanation-3: -These tubes are called the ureters. The bladder stores urine until it’s time to urinate. Urine leaves the body through another small tube called the urethra.
